Sesame Broccoflower® Stir Fry

SUBMITTED BY: Tanimura & Antle®

"Broccoflower® is stir-fried with red pepper and onion then served in a sauce with sesame seeds. Serve over steamed rice or noodles."

INGREDIENTS (Nutrition)

  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il
  • 1 head Broccoflower®, cut into 1 inch pieces
  • 1/2 cup red onion, sliced
  • 1/2 cup red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 1/4 cups chicken stock or broth
  • 1 tablespoon cornstarch
  • 1/8 cup chicken stock
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ons toasted sesame seeds

DIRECTIONS

  1. Dissolve cornstarch in 1/4 cup chicken stock. Heat wok or frying pan over high heat. Add sesame oil to coat pan. Add Broccoflower®, red peppers, stir-fry for 1 minute. Add red onion, 1 tablespoon sesame seeds and continue to cook for one minute.
  2. Add chicken stock and bring to a boil. Add cornstarch mixture and soy sauce and bring back to a boil while stirring. When sauce has thickened, remove from heat. Place in serving dish and sprinkle remaining sesame seeds on top.

FOOTNOTES

  • Hints: You can use canned chicken stock or vegetable stock.
